Ordinals
alpha
Sat 1512152410362298
decimal
394860.2410362298
degree
0°184860′1740″2410362298‴
percentile
72.00725771550792%
name
ddfyxanepbz
cycle
0
epoch
1
period
195
block
394860
offset
2410362298
rarity
common
timestamp
2016-01-24 20:52:29 UTC
prev
next